直接刚度法,对支承条件有“先处理法”和“后处理法”。对杆系结构的铰结点,需要建立许多单元刚度矩阵。在程序中要输入不同结点性质信息。因此,本文提出用“虚链杆代换的方法,在结构简图上“先处理非刚性结点”。使10种以上的单元刚度矩阵减少到两种,使6种以上的梁式杆减少到1种,使非结点荷载的相关性减少到6与1之比。
